On board the Type 12 general purpose frigate Plymouth (1959) alongside the south side of number 3 basin in Chatham Dockyard at the end of a modernization which commenced in August 1966. The ship is berthed starboard side to the quay. The photographer is in the N.B.C. (nuclear, biological, chemical) store between 64 and 65 stations on the centreline of 3 deck looking to starboard showing open shelving against the forward bulkhead and protective clothing hanging on crinkle bars against the aft bulkhead. A vertical format negative.
